区块链游戏,从入门到反思了解区块链游戏教案反思

区块链游戏,从入门到反思了解区块链游戏教案反思,

本文目录导读:

  1. 区块链游戏的概述
  2. 区块链游戏的技术基础
  3. 区块链游戏的教学设计
  4. 案例分析
  5. 教学反思

在数字技术日新月异的今天,区块链技术以其去中心化、不可篡改的特性,正在改变我们对游戏的理解,区块链游戏(Blockchain Game)作为一种新型的游戏形式,不仅改变了玩家的互动方式,还重塑了游戏的开发模式,随着区块链技术的不断发展,区块链游戏的应用场景也在不断扩大,从娱乐到教育,从金融到医疗,区块链游戏的影响已经渗透到社会的方方面面,如何有效地教授区块链游戏,以及在教学过程中进行反思,成为一个值得深入探讨的话题。

本文将从区块链游戏的基本概念入手,分析其技术基础,探讨如何设计区块链游戏的教学课程,并通过案例分析,总结教学中的经验和反思,最终为未来的区块链游戏教学提供参考。

区块链游戏的概述

区块链游戏是一种基于区块链技术的游戏形式,它利用区块链的分布式账本和密码学特性,为游戏提供新的互动方式和验证机制,区块链游戏的参与者可以通过参与游戏获得奖励,这些奖励以加密货币的形式存储在区块链账本中,具有不可篡改和可追溯的特性。

区块链游戏的核心特征包括:

  1. 分布式账本:区块链游戏的记录是通过多个节点共同维护的,任何单个节点都无法独自更改记录,确保数据的完整性和安全性。

  2. 不可篡改:区块链的记录是加密存储的,任何篡改都需要密码被破解,因此具有极高的安全性。

  3. 透明可追溯:区块链的记录是公开透明的,所有参与者的行动和奖励都可以被追溯,增加了游戏的可信度。

  4. 去中心化:区块链游戏的规则和奖励分配不依赖于中心化的机构,参与者可以通过协议自主决定游戏的规则和奖励分配方式。

区块链游戏的技术基础

区块链游戏的技术基础主要包括以下几个方面:

  1. 共识机制:区块链游戏的规则和奖励分配需要通过共识机制来达成一致,常见的共识机制包括 Proof of Work(POW)、Proof of Stake(POS)和 Practical Byzantine Fault Tolerance(PBFT),POW 通过计算难度来竞争区块的奖励,POS 通过持有代币的权重来分配奖励,PBFT 通过拜占庭将军问题来解决共识问题。

  2. 密码学:区块链游戏的安全性依赖于密码学算法,例如哈希函数、椭圆曲线加密和零知识证明等,这些算法确保了区块链游戏的不可篡改性和隐私性。

  3. 智能合约:区块链游戏中的智能合约是自动执行的合同,它根据预设的规则自动处理交易和奖励分配,智能合约减少了 intermediaries 的干预,提高了游戏的公平性和透明度。

  4. NFT(非同质化代币):NFT 是区块链技术的一种应用,它将游戏中的物品、角色或任务以加密货币的形式表示,NFT 具有唯一性和不可转移性,可以用于游戏中的交易和奖励分配。

区块链游戏的教学设计

在区块链游戏的教学设计中,我们需要考虑以下几个方面:

  1. 课程目标:区块链游戏的教学目标包括了解区块链游戏的基本概念、技术原理和应用场景,掌握区块链游戏的开发工具和方法,培养玩家的创新能力和团队协作能力。

  2. 需要覆盖区块链游戏的概述、技术基础、智能合约、NFT、区块链游戏的开发工具以及区块链游戏的案例分析等。

  3. 教学方法:教学方法可以采用讲授法、案例分析法、实践操作法、小组讨论法等多种形式,以提高学生的学习兴趣和参与度。

  4. 评价方式:评价方式可以采用理论考试、实践操作、案例分析和团队项目等多种形式,全面评估学生的学习效果。

案例分析

以下是一个典型的区块链游戏案例——《NFT游戏》。

在《NFT游戏》中,玩家可以通过购买和销售 NFT 来获得游戏内的物品和任务,游戏中的 NFT 是通过智能合约自动分配的,玩家可以通过完成任务获得奖励,奖励以 NFT 的形式存储在区块链账本中,游戏中的规则包括 NFT 的购买价格、任务的难度、奖励的分配等,这些规则都是通过智能合约自动执行的。

通过这个案例,我们可以看到区块链游戏如何利用区块链技术来实现游戏的透明性和不可篡改性,这个案例也展示了区块链游戏如何通过 NFT 实现游戏物品的唯一性和不可转移性。

教学反思

在区块链游戏的教学过程中,我们遇到了许多问题和挑战,学生对区块链技术的了解程度不一,导致部分学生在学习过程中感到吃力,区块链游戏的开发工具和平台需要一定的技术支持,这增加了教学的难度,区块链游戏的案例分析需要学生具备一定的编程能力和逻辑思维能力,这也对教学提出了更高的要求。

针对这些问题,我们可以采取以下措施:

  1. 因材施教:根据学生的不同学习水平和兴趣,制定个性化的教学方案,提供不同的学习资源和指导。

  2. 加强基础知识教学:在教学过程中,加强区块链技术基础知识的讲解,帮助学生打牢基础,提高学习效果。

  3. 简化教学内容:针对学生的实际情况,简化教学内容,避免过于复杂的技术细节,提高学生的学习兴趣和参与度。

  4. 利用在线平台:利用区块链游戏的在线平台,让学生在课后进行自主学习和实践,提高学生的自主学习能力。

区块链游戏作为一种新型的游戏形式,正在改变我们对游戏的理解和参与方式,通过区块链技术的去中心化、不可篡改和透明可追溯的特性,区块链游戏为游戏的规则和奖励分配提供了新的可能性,在教学过程中,我们需要根据学生的实际情况,设计适合的教学内容和方法,通过案例分析和实践操作,提高学生的学习效果和创新能力。

随着区块链技术的不断发展,区块链游戏的应用场景和教学形式也会不断丰富,我们期待在区块链游戏的教学中,能够不断探索新的教学方法和模式,培养更多具备创新能力和团队协作能力的高素质人才。

区块链游戏,从入门到反思了解区块链游戏教案反思,

发表评论